TAPMI Breaks Into QS World Ranking's 101+ Band

T A Pai Management Institute (TAPMI) has added another feather to its’s hat by featuring in the prestigious QS World Ranking Management School rankings. The QS World University Rankings is the most widely read university rankings in the world. 

The QS rankings evaluate business schools’ performance relative to their key missions, whilst accounting for what matters most for prospective students. The core metrics include employability (35%), Alumni Outcomes (15%), Value for Money (20%), Thought Leadership (20%) and Diversity (10%).

University of Texas at Arlington, University of South Carolina, Liverpool Management School, Georgia State, and Rensselaer Polytechnic are placed in the same 101+ band as TAPMI. Amongst the top 100 in this rankings, only three Indian B-Schools have found a place – IIMB (26), IIMA (27) and IIMC (46). Some of the global schools that find a place in the top 100 QS Management School rankings are HEC Paris, London Business School, IE Business School, Duke (Fuqua), Michigan (Ross), Imperial College, Warwick and Trinity College Dublin among others.

Recently, TAPMI earned the double crown of AMBA and AACSB accreditation. The feat has propelled the institute to an elite club of five eminent business schools in India.
